    I am an editor and just received footage that was shot with WAY too much gain- it’s very noticeable. Some of the tapes are fine, but key ones aren’t. Is there any way to at least somewhat offset this issue?

    The Neat Video Noise Reduction plugin is just the ticket. You can try their free demo…

    Make sure to watch their online tutorial so you can achieve the best results.
